Marseille is the second-largest city in France. Its metropolitan area is the third-largest in France after those of Paris and Lyon.

A calanque is a narrow, steep-walled inlet that is developed in limestone, dolomite, or other carbonate strata and found along the Mediterranean coast.

Hike on the trail from calanque to calanque: Callelongue, la Mounine, Marseilleveyre, des Queyrons, to finish at the magnificent calanque of Podestat.
